Output fd7521095db3cba21600b9a83e5133793c4fa3979c586df6dc0caea51faa00ba:0

value
3762519
script pubkey
OP_0 OP_PUSHBYTES_20 c2eba9dcaca7a2676a9a1603b07d99559d7bc865
address
bc1qct46nh9v573xw656zcpmqlve2kwhhjr977sguq
transaction
fd7521095db3cba21600b9a83e5133793c4fa3979c586df6dc0caea51faa00ba